In recent years, vibration plates have gained popularity as a fitness tool, promoting muscle strength, flexibility, and overall health. However, there’s an emerging discussion surrounding the relationship between vibration plates and blood clots. In this article, we will explore how vibration plates work, their potential benefits, and their implications for those concerned about blood clots.

Understanding Vibration Plates

Vibration plates are exercise machines that produce vibrations while you stand, sit, or perform exercises on them. The vibrations stimulate muscle contractions, which can enhance the effectiveness of workouts. Users often report benefits such as improved circulation, increased muscle strength, and enhanced flexibility.

How Vibration Plates Work

The mechanism of vibration plates is simple yet effective. When you stand on the platform, it oscillates, causing your muscles to contract rapidly. This reflexive response can lead to:

  • Increased muscle activation
  • Improved blood circulation
  • Enhanced metabolic rate
  • Greater flexibility

These benefits make vibration plates appealing for individuals looking to enhance their fitness routine without the strain of traditional exercises.

The Link Between Vibration Plates and Blood Clots

Blood clots can pose serious health risks, especially if they lead to conditions such as deep vein thrombosis (DVT) or pulmonary embolism. Understanding the implications of using vibration plates for individuals at risk of blood clots is critical.

Blood Clots: What You Need to Know

Blood clots form when blood thickens and clumps together, which can obstruct blood flow. This can occur in veins or arteries and can lead to severe complications. Risk factors for blood clots include:

  • Prolonged immobility (e.g., long flights or bed rest)
  • Obesity
  • Smoking
  • Certain medical conditions (e.g., cancer, heart disease)
  • Hormonal factors (e.g., birth control pills)

For individuals at risk, staying active is crucial in preventing blood clots. This is where vibration plates may play a role.

Can Vibration Plates Help Prevent Blood Clots?

Research on the effectiveness of vibration plates specifically for preventing blood clots is limited. However, there are several ways in which vibration plates may contribute to better blood circulation:

  • Increased Circulation: The vibrations from the plate stimulate blood flow, which can help prevent stagnation and reduce the risk of clot formation.
  • Muscle Activation: Engaging muscles while using a vibration plate can enhance venous return, aiding in blood flow back to the heart.
  • Reduced Muscle Tension: The gentle vibrations may help reduce muscle tension, promoting relaxation and further improving circulation.

Precautions When Using Vibration Plates

While vibration plates can offer some benefits, it’s essential to approach their use with caution, especially for individuals at risk of blood clots. Here are some precautions to consider:

Consult Your Doctor

If you have a history of blood clots or other related health issues, consult with a healthcare professional before incorporating vibration plates into your routine. They can provide personalized advice based on your health status.

Start Slowly

For beginners or those who have not been active for a while, it’s crucial to start slowly. Begin with short sessions on the vibration plate and gradually increase the duration and intensity over time.

Stay Hydrated

Dehydration can contribute to blood clot formation. Ensure you drink plenty of water before and after using a vibration plate to maintain hydration levels.

The Benefits of Vibration Plates Beyond Blood Clot Prevention

While the potential relationship between vibration plates and blood clots is an essential aspect to consider, vibration plates offer a variety of other health benefits:

1. Muscle Strength and Tone

Regular use of vibration plates can enhance muscle strength and tone by engaging multiple muscle groups simultaneously. This can lead to improved overall fitness and body composition.

2. Improved Flexibility

The gentle oscillations of the vibration plate can help improve flexibility and range of motion. This is particularly beneficial for athletes or individuals recovering from injuries.

3. Enhanced Weight Loss

Vibration plates can aid in weight loss when combined with a balanced diet and regular exercise. The increased metabolic rate and calorie burn during sessions can contribute to overall weight management.

4. Better Balance and Coordination

Using a vibration plate can improve balance and coordination, making it a valuable tool for older adults or individuals undergoing rehabilitation.
